Rate of Pay: 17.96 - 23.47 per hour Summary: We are seeking a detail-oriented and organised Technical Officer to provide administrative and technical support to the Waste & Cleaning service within Southwark Council. The role will focus on monitoring service requests creating statistical reports and supporting service delivery improvements. This is a key role in ensuring accurate data management efficient administration and effective communication with stakeholders. Responsibilities: Monitor and create statistical information associated with service requests and failures.Input data accurately into spreadsheets (Microsoft Excel) SAP and other systems ensuring information is up to date and reliable.File and archive records both electronically and manually in line with council policies.Analyse tonnage and service data providing recommendations for improving efficiency and delivery.Deal with written and oral enquiries and complaints providing clear and professional responses. Qualifications: Minimum of 4 GCSEs at Grade C or above (or equivalent) including Maths and English. Experiences:At least 1 year of experience delivering front-line services or managing service-related data/contracts.Experience using SAP or similar systems for finance monitoring and reporting (desirable).Experience of delivering excellent customer service.Experience of working collaboratively with internal and external stakeholders. Requirements:Proficiency in Microsoft Excel Word and Outlook at an intermediate level.Strong knowledge of data entry monitoring and statistical reporting processes.Understanding of customer service principles ideally within a public sector environment.Ability to plan organise and prioritise workloads effectively.Excellent written and verbal communication skills with the ability to liaise with diverse stakeholders.Accuracy and attention to detail in handling data and documentation.
